POMONA, CA — Holley and DuPont Automotive Finishes, the major sponsors of last year’s inaugural NHRA National Hot Rod Reunion, have signed on again for the second annual event. The second annual Holley NHRA National Hot Rod Reunion, presented by DuPont Automotive Finishes, is set for June 18-20, at Beech Bend Park, in Bowling Green, Ky.

“We couldn’t ask for better sponsors,” said Sam Jackson, executive director of the Wally Parks NHRA Motorsports Museum in Pomona, Calif., producers of the festive 3-day hot rod extravaganza. “Holley and DuPont have long histories within the hot rod and street rod communities. They helped make the first National Reunion a resounding success and we look forward to their presence making the second one even better.”

Like last year, Holley is the title sponsor while DuPont Automotive Finishes is the presenting sponsor. “Teaming with the Wally Parks NHRA Motorsports Museum on last year’s National Reunion surpassed all our expectations,” said Jason Bruce, director of marketing for Holley, which has been headquartered in Bowling Green for more than a half-century. “The buzz has been very strong on last year’s Reunion. It had everything – street rods, drag racing on all levels, customs, classics and hot rods. No wonder it went over so well. And I think this one will be twice as big.”

Dennis Silva, DuPont Custom Finishes business manager, agreed. “We are still hearing about it. It was the best first-time event we’ve been part of. It was an instant classic. This year will be incredible. We’re glad to be part of the team presenting it.”

Produced by the Wally Parks NHRA Motorsports Museum, the Holley National Hot Rod Reunion, presented by DuPont Automotive Finishes, will include Crane Cams nostalgic drag racing in such classes at Top Fuel, Supercharged Gassers, classic Funny Cars and Super Stocks, along with a giant street rod, customs, classics and muscle car SofffSeal “show n’ shine,” swap meet for classic car and racing parts, special stage show and a separate amusement park with rides and games for all ages adjacent to the park.

Fashioned after the annual NHRA California Hot Rod Reunion in Bakersfield, the event also includes the all-time favorite “Cacklefest” under the stars. The activity involves early-days-style front-engine dragsters being push-started, then all gathered together on the drag strip starting-line with engines running.

The Holley NHRA National Hot Rod Reunion, presented by DuPont Automotive Refinishes, will also cater to car clubs, with special contests and activities for clubs. Proceeds of the Holley Hot Rod Reunion, presented by DuPont Automotive Refinishes, will benefit the Wally Parks NHRA Motorsports Museum. The museum houses the very roots of hot rodding. Scores of famous vehicles spanning American motorsports history are on display, including winning cars representing 50 years of drag racing, dry lakes and salt-flat racers, oval track challengers and exhibits describing their colorful backgrounds.
